Solon offers several picturesque driving routes perfect for a relaxing weekend escape. The Chagrin River Road provides a beautiful journey through lush forests and alongside the meandering Chagrin River. As you drive, you'll encounter charming covered bridges and quaint small towns. Another option is the Cuyahoga Valley Scenic Byway, which winds through the stunning Cuyahoga Valley National Park. This route offers breathtaking views of waterfalls, rolling hills, and historic sites. For a more urban scenic drive, consider exploring the Cleveland Metroparks system, known as the "Emerald Necklace," which encircles Cleveland with beautiful parkways and natural areas. When driving from Solon to Cleveland, there are several pleasant spots to take a break and enjoy the scenery. The South Chagrin Reservation, part of the Cleveland Metroparks, offers beautiful natural surroundings with hiking trails and picnic areas. It's an ideal place to stretch your legs and enjoy a brief respite. Another option is the Shaker Lakes area, which provides serene views and walking paths around its picturesque bodies of water. For those interested in history, a stop at the James A. Garfield National Historic Site in nearby Mentor can be both educational and refreshing. Preparing for winter driving in Solon requires careful planning. First, ensure your rental car is equipped with all-season or winter tires for better traction on snowy roads. Familiarize yourself with the vehicle's features, such as anti-lock brakes and traction control. Pack an ice scraper, snow brush, and warm clothing in case of unexpected delays. Before setting out, clear all snow and ice from your vehicle, including the roof, to ensure good visibility. Drive slowly and increase your following distance from other vehicles. Be extra cautious on bridges and overpasses, which freeze faster than regular roads. It's also wise to keep your fuel tank at least half full to prevent fuel line freezing. Lastly, stay informed about weather conditions and road closures in Solon and surrounding areas before and during your trip.
Visitors exploring the outskirts of Solon can find reliable gas stations along major routes and in neighboring communities. The intersection of SOM Center Road and Aurora Road in Solon itself hosts several well-known gas station brands. As you venture further out, you'll find stations along main thoroughfares like Route 422 and I-480. Many of these locations offer convenience stores for snacks and basic supplies. It's advisable to refuel when your tank reaches half-empty, especially when exploring less populated areas. Some stations also provide electric vehicle charging points, catering to a range of vehicle types.
